This Saturday morning is the 2015 Health & Business Expo at the Navarre Conference Center. There will be local health agencies and businesses that will offer many free health screenings. It is a great opportunity to meet doctors and health professionals in the area. Woodlands Medical Specialists will offer free flu shots to the first 25 attendees. There will also be door prizes and a chance to win a 40” LED Smart TV. Check out the Navarre Beach Chamber’s ad for more details. There will also be a blood mobile at the Health Expo.
